Transaction 61b05f1ca345657fc630e12ea5959b684aa15f9085d877883b1256aea69ca9f8
1 Input
1 Output
-
61b05f1ca345657fc630e12ea5959b684aa15f9085d877883b1256aea69ca9f8:0
- value
- 15845769
- script pubkey
- OP_0 OP_PUSHBYTES_20 f51180b0540a84b0372208de0a21a01c27355d7c
- address
- bc1q75gcpvz5p2ztqdezpr0q5gdqrsnn2htu8uewjv